Bella Scally Conquers London Marathon, Raising GBP1,400 for Macmillan Cancer Support

Bella Scally, a valued member of Warner Goodman LLP's Private Client team, completes the challenging London Marathon for Macmillan Cancer Support.

At the start of the year, Bella set an ambitious goal for 2024: to accomplish something she had never done before and challenge herself both physically and mentally. Her decision to apply for and participate in the iconic London Marathon was a bold move that set her on a path of intense training and preparation.

The London Marathon is one of the most prestigious and sought-after running events worldwide, with over 500,000 applicants each year and only 50,000 spots available.

After securing a place, Macmillan Cancer Support contacted Bella, inviting her to run on their behalf. Inspired by the invaluable support her family received from Macmillan during a difficult time, Bella was honoured to give back to this incredible charity.

Over the past 13 weeks, Bella adhered to a disciplined training regimen, overcoming minor injuries and challenges along the way. Her dedication paid off as she completed the 26.2-mile course in 5 hours and 41 minutes, earning a prestigious marathon medal.

"The atmosphere was incredible! Macmillan had cheer points throughout the course, providing a boost when I needed it most," Bella shared. "My friends and family were also there to cheer me on, dressed in green wigs and holding homemade signs. It was a truly special experience."

Although Bella didn't achieve her initial goal of finishing in under 5 hours, she was proud of her accomplishment. "I'm delighted with my time, especially considering the shin splints I experienced in the last half of the race. At one point, I even thought I wouldn't make it to the finish line!

"For someone who doesn't consider themselves a natural runner, I'm proud of what I accomplished. Joining the exclusive 0.01% of the world's population who have completed a marathon is an incredible feeling. Thank you to everyone for their support - I couldn't have done it without all the kind words and messages!" Bella reflected.

Bella's marathon journey raised an impressive £1,400 for Macmillan Cancer Support, bringing her total fundraising efforts to £2,000. This generous contribution will have a meaningful impact on the organisation's mission to provide support and resources to those affected by cancer.

Looking ahead, Bella is eager to continue her marathon journey. She plans to participate in marathons worldwide and has already been invited to join the Amsterdam Marathon later this year.
